CI Note — Tallyfork Export Memory

If the spreadsheet export job OOMs in CI, check whether your branch buffers whole workbooks instead of streaming rows. The Tallyfork runner caps jobs at 1 GB. Don't raise the cap; fix the writer. Baseline numbers come from the build referenced below.

build token for tahop-fafof: htk14_2d55df8101eccc

The renewal of our three-year agreement with Torvane Materials has been assessed in detail. Proposed terms include a 4.2% unit-price increase, partially offset by improved volume rebates and extended payment terms of sixty days. Sensitivity analysis indicates a net annual cost impact of under 1% on the Meridia product line, assuming stable demand. Legal has flagged no material changes to liability clauses. We recommend approval, subject to the conditions outlined in the confidential note below.

confidential, yawip-bahif: Zorokox Partners plans to lower the Casax list price by 28.0 percent in April. The board signed off on a budget of $271.0 million for Project Juldor. The renewal with Pelokox Partners closes at $410.1 million a year, 3.4 percent below the last contract. Project Pelok slips by a full year because of the audit delay.

Changed defaults in Splitfork, our assignment service. Bucketing now uses sticky hashing per account instead of per session, and the holdout slice grew from 2% to 5%. Callers relying on session-level reassignment must opt in explicitly. Review the diff against the new baseline; the updated default configuration is listed below.

config for tagep-kajof:
[casir]
port = 6379
region = south-1
host = casir.paliqdyn.example
team = tamax
timeout_ms = 250
retries = 2

Ticket: Query planner regression on the Marwick reporting cluster. Support has seen slow dashboard reports since Tuesday; cause is configuration drift — the planner cost settings on two replicas no longer match the primary, so large joins pick a bad index path. Workaround until the fix lands: route heavy reports to the primary. The correct planner settings are listed below.

deployment values, bahop-yadug:
[caswyn]
port = 8443
region = east-4
host = caswyn.lumicworks.internal
timeout_ms = 5000
retries = 8